Bad Boys for Life Greater Philadelphia Area Seat Report T-3 and Counting Sellouts Showings Seats Sold Total Seats Perct Sold TOTALS 0 40 932 8,844 10.54% Comp 1.432x of Once Upon 3 days before release (8.3M) 0.602x of It: Chapter Two (6.32M) 0.463x of Joker (6.16M) 3.932x of Gemini Man (6.29M) 3.655x of Terminator (8.59M) 6.340x of 21 Bridges (4.44M) Adjusted Comp 0.193x of The Lion King (4.44M) 1.689x of Hobbs & Shaw (9.8M) At first glance, this is probably going to make people here go nuts and expect this to hit 80M or something. However, it's important to recognize Philly demographics. Philly is a majority black city, and Will Smith was born and raised in West Philadelphia. So yeah, there's a lot of Bad Boys fans here. But on the other hand, that's still very strong interest and indicates it should still do a lot of money nationwide I feel. It's especially helped since both el sid and Inceptionzq's data indicate good things. Of course, Inception's data is also skewed since Denver has a significant Latino demographic. But regardless of all that, it would not surprise me if Bad Boys gets to 40M for the 3-Day, at least as of now.
